Today, we explore the idiom 「矯情飾詐」. Below, we’ll cover its meaning and practical uses.
To deceive others by disguising false phenomena.
The Mandarin pronunciation of this idiom is :
jiǎo qíng shì zhà
while its Cantonese pinyin is :
giu2 ching4 sik1 ja3
